
Jsp学习文档
文章平均质量分 77
hbuzhang
这个作者很懒,什么都没留下…
展开
-
使用jsp实现word、excel格式报表打印
title: 使用JSP实现WORD、EXCEL格式报表打印author: evandate: 2003-08-21因为ms word和excel的文档都支持html文本格式,因此可以先用word或excel做好模版,另存为Web页,然后将该html改成jsp,将数据部分动态填入即可,不用很辛苦的调整格式 word页面只要在jsp头设置如下指令: excel如下:使用这种方式客户端必须安装有off原创 2004-11-29 14:38:00 · 1404 阅读 · 0 评论 -
在JSP页面中轻松实现数据饼图4
附:本文全部源代码 Listing E <%@ page language="java" %> <%@ page import="java.io.OutputStream" %><%@ page import="java.sql.*" %><%@ page import="java.awt.*" %><%@ page import="java.awt.geom.*" %><%@ p原创 2004-11-30 20:39:00 · 1209 阅读 · 0 评论 -
JSP显示内容缓存技巧(一)
前段时间做自己社区的论坛,在jive的基础上做一个页面显示所有论坛的帖子,可以称之为总版,模仿Forum类的接口做个SuperForum并且实现Cachable,不过因为这个页面刷新量比较大,虽然被Cache了,我还是想办法进行页面的缓存,感觉用jsp产生的html静态内容当缓存,页面访问速度应该有所提高。 首先想到的一种办法,是采用java.net的URLConnection把服务器上的jsp原创 2004-11-30 21:18:00 · 1368 阅读 · 0 评论 -
JSP显示内容缓存技巧(二)
附件源代码 不过采用resin服务器的话,以上代码会失效。因为resin没有实现getWriter方法,而是采用getOutputStream取而代之,所以必须修改些代码来迎合resin运行环境:/** * START File FileCaptureResponseWrapper.java */package com.junjing.filter;import javax.原创 2004-11-30 21:20:00 · 973 阅读 · 0 评论 -
浅谈B/S系统安全
这是发表在原公司(已经在股东们个人利益斗争中轰然倒塌)内部BBS上的一篇贴子,随便贴上来,(为保护在用系统及其它有部分删节及修改),适合初学者! hjleochen@hotmail.comhttp://www.safechina.net (转载请注明出处)----------------------------------------------------------- 浅谈B/S系原创 2004-12-07 01:04:00 · 4894 阅读 · 0 评论 -
用Javascript制作一个可自动填写的文本框(一) 选择自 yjgx007 的 Blog
优快云 - 文档中心 - Javascript 阅读:8074 评论: 1 参与评论 标题 用Javascript制作一个可自动填写的文本框(一) 选择自 yjgx007 的 Blog 关键字 IE Opera Mozilla TextRange 浏览器检测出处 http://ww原创 2004-12-13 21:48:00 · 3431 阅读 · 0 评论 -
JSP彩色验证码
JSP彩色验证码 生成有4个随机数字和杂乱背景的图片,数字和背景颜色会改变,服务器端刷新(用history.go(-1)也会变) 原型参考ALIBABA http://china.alibaba.com/member/showimage 产生验证码图片的文件image.jspjava.awt.image.*,java.util.*,javax.imageio.*" %>C原创 2004-12-24 03:22:00 · 1804 阅读 · 2 评论 -
JSP调用存储过程的问题
主题: JSP调用存储过程的问题! 最后时间: 2004-12-23 下午2:29 总回复: 14 页: 1 该主题总专家分:0 可给专家分:0 <!-- -->[ 回复主题 ] 回复: 14,原创 2004-12-24 10:46:00 · 3490 阅读 · 0 评论 -
购买物品的累加计算,选中即开始加减,非常方便
设为首页 加入收藏 联系我们 首页 | 推荐软件 | 最新软件 | 源码下载 | 模板下载 | 教程下载 | 软件分类 | 软件搜索 | JS特效 | 技术文档 | 论坛 JS实例特效: 购买物品的累加计算,选中即开始加减,非常方便 演示区:<!-- Begin <!-- beg原创 2005-02-01 20:15:00 · 1301 阅读 · 0 评论 -
中文编码转换说明
一 原理环境:Page : Jsp,HtmlServer: TomcatDB : InformixJsp 文件中需添加%@page contentType="text/html;charset=gb2312" %>才能正确显示中文的GBK编码Html文件中需添加才能正确显示中文的GBK编码一般编码过程:1 在jsp页面输入字符串(含中文或者其它),提交2 后台将字符串原创 2005-02-03 08:28:00 · 4296 阅读 · 1 评论 -
Web应用导出Excel报表的简单实现(HTML)
Web应用导出Excel报表的简单实现 在Web应用中,很多数据经常要导出成Excel文档。用专门的生成真正的Excel文档的方式比较复杂,不太好用。所以经常用一种简单的方式来实现,即将报表保存为HTML格式,然后用Excel打开。 实现方式: 第一步,用JSP实现HTML版本的报表 第二步,在该JSP页面头部设置response的ContentType为Excel格式原创 2005-03-13 19:48:00 · 1881 阅读 · 0 评论 -
在JSP页面中轻松实现数据饼图
制做可调整的边界 图A中的饼状图形有一边界,如何能改变边界的大小呢?可以先定义int border = 10,然后计算边界内面积的大小而实现: Ellipse2D.Double elb = new Ellipse2D.Double(x_pie - border/2, y_pie - border/2, pieWidth + border, pieHeight + border); x_pie和原创 2004-11-30 20:37:00 · 3968 阅读 · 0 评论 -
从页面中取出e-mail地址和相对链接及绝对链接的代码...
private string FetchPage(String url) //取页面指定URL页面的源码 { String page = "null"; try { WebClient mywc = new WebClient(); using(Stream strm = mywc.OpenRead(url)) { StreamReader sr = new StreamReader(st原创 2004-11-29 15:14:00 · 1634 阅读 · 0 评论 -
JSP连接Mysql实战
[原创] tack 2003-10-05 对于初学者用jsp+tomcat+mysql搭建j2ee算是个理想的运行环境。以往用惯了php的内置的mysql函数, jsp与mysql的连接显得有点麻烦,同时这方面的资料也有点缺乏,所以jsp与数据库的连接成为初学者的第一道门槛,jsp无法连接数据库,无疑对学习造成了巨大的阻碍。其实跨过去了,就会觉得很简单。接下来进入下面没有几个ste原创 2004-12-05 00:25:00 · 1184 阅读 · 0 评论 -
Jsp结合XML+XSLT将输出转换为Html格式
我们知道 XML+XSLT就可以直接输出到支持XML的浏览器上,如IE 5.0以上,但是,我们还要考虑到有不少浏览器不直接支持XML,在这种情况下,我们需要在服务器上进行转换成html输出到浏览器,这种临时过渡办法恐怕要在一段时间内一直要使用. 使用Jsp 加上tablib标识库,我们可以完成这种转换。 著名open source项目组jakarta.apache.org推出的系列标原创 2004-11-30 20:46:00 · 735 阅读 · 0 评论 -
用 正则表达式 判断一个简单的用户登陆的例
bd.jsp /* 数据只能为a-z,A-Z,0-9的字符的正则表达式的例子. 正则表达式在做程序登陆的过程非常重要。不然用´ or ´ 等语句就可以很容易绕过您的程度判断; 作者:高颂 QQ:932246 一个简单的例子但是很有用,希望起到抛砖引玉的作用。 */ String temp ="我是非法的字符"; String name = request.getParameter("name")原创 2004-12-01 16:19:00 · 896 阅读 · 0 评论 -
http://fason.nease.net里有一些关于asp的树的下载
http://fason.nease.net原创 2004-12-01 16:56:00 · 974 阅读 · 0 评论 -
JS访问XML的简单例子
JS_XML.htmvar iIndex=-1;var objectDoc=new ActiveXObject("MSXML2.DOMDocument.3.0");objectDoc.load("Root.xml");var objectItem=objectDoc.selectNodes("/Root/Item");function getNode(objectDoc,strPath){ v原创 2004-12-03 23:46:00 · 1081 阅读 · 0 评论 -
Tomcat环境中servlet的配置方法
在web.xml中写上:voteServlet vote.voteServlet 其中voteServlet是文件的名字vote是文件的包名。 voteServlet /voteServlet 其中第一行的voteServlet为文件的名字,第二行中的/voteServlet也是文件的名字,只是加一个/罢了;在Servlet技术中如果实现的是:Get命令则只要在web.xml中注册即可。URL为原创 2004-11-29 14:09:00 · 1313 阅读 · 0 评论 -
JSP实现论坛树型结构的具体算法
实现论坛树型结构的算法很多,具体你可以去www.chinaasp.com的全文搜索中查询。我现在的JSP论坛采用的也是当中的一种:不用递归实现树型结构的算法,现在我将论坛树型结构的具体算法和大家介绍一下,和大家一起交流。 1、演示表的结构: 表名:mybbslist 字段 数据类型 说明 BBSID 自动编号 RootID Int 根原创 2004-11-30 20:42:00 · 812 阅读 · 0 评论 -
一个用JSP实现的分页的类及调用方法
//PageCt.java 分页的类/**** @version ************** Created on 2001年6月25日, 下午14:41***************************************/package vod;import java.sql.*;import java.util.*; public class PageCt{private原创 2004-11-30 21:11:00 · 848 阅读 · 0 评论 -
也谈JSP与XML的交互
天极网5月2号发表的《JSP与XML的结合》一文中对JSP与XML的交互只提到一种使用标记库的方法,JSP与XML交互还有两种重要的方法,因此在本文中我想简要阐述一下,以作为《JSP与XML的结合》的补充。 使用JavaServer Pages有三种不同的方法用于处理XML文档,每种方法都有利于提高分离页面代码与XML数据的水平,有利于简化开发网页的复杂度并且改善提高组件与页面代码的可重用性。原创 2004-12-02 13:13:00 · 1353 阅读 · 0 评论 -
Textarea标签封装为Web在线编辑器
Editor.htmEditor.htc//对象var vColorObject=null;var vFontObject=null;var vFontFamilyDiv=null;var vFontSizeDiv=null;var vFileObject=null;var vConsoleDiv=null;var vEditorDiv=null;//按钮提示文本var str原创 2004-12-03 23:43:00 · 1483 阅读 · 0 评论 -
在JSP页面中轻松实现数据饼图2
获取总销售量 在多数情况下,销售列表中会有很多个记录,所以访问数据库的快捷性和高效性显得非常重要。现在我们只需要访问数据库中每一种产品的总额销售量。 表C中的getSales()方法与数据库连接并返回一个数组,这个数组包含每一种产品的总额出售量。 Listing C //////////////////////////////////////////////////////原创 2004-11-30 20:33:00 · 1153 阅读 · 0 评论 -
Jsp结合XML+XSLT将输出转换为Html格式2
我们的做法是:<%@taglib uri="xsl.jar" prefix="xsl" %> 我们以Jakarta的XSL taglib附带的Apply.jsp为例,正好了解一下Jsp XML XSLT三者之间的关系: Apply.jsp <%@taglib uri="xsl.jar" prefix="xsl" %> <html><head><ti原创 2004-11-30 20:47:00 · 1393 阅读 · 0 评论 -
在查询页面中显示进度条,在数据load成功后隐去进度条 选择自 chensheng913 的 Blog
function onSubmit() { var waitingInfo = document.getElementById(getNetuiTagName("waitingInfo")); waitingInfo.style.display = ""; //show the ProgressBar progress_update(); //begin the progressba原创 2005-04-14 08:16:00 · 1839 阅读 · 0 评论